人牙早期釉质龋的发生、发展机理尚有许多不明之处,早期龋釉质的通透性在龋病发生发展中的作用研究和报道甚少,本文采用扫描电镜技术,生物化学方法和细菌学方法对人牙早期釉质的通透性加以研究观察。结果发现葡萄糖和细菌能穿过早期龋釉质表层进入表层下,扫描电镜图象也证实早期龋损表层下的损害主体内有细菌生长繁殖。本文结果表明,早期龋釉质对糖和细菌具有一定通透性,这种通透性是早期龋得以进一步发展的必要条件。
